Here is the recount I wrote  for an Asttle writing test in Week 4.  Our teacher marked all our recounts and gave us our scores. Mine came out at Level 3B which is at the end of year standard for Year Five. I got the lowest points for ideas, vocabulary and punctuation and the best scores for structure and sentences. 
We helped each other improve them by reading each other’s recount and talking about them. We also used Revision Assistant to help edit each other’s story and Mrs B added some notes as well. Everyone in our room likes Revision Assistant because it’s easy to understand the marks/ notes that it puts on your writing and so it’s quick for us to go and do the fix-ups. We have to have practically perfect grammar, punctuation and spelling in our stories before we are allowed to publish them here. I hope someone will give me some feedback.
